Ocasio-Cortez's Fundraising Surges Amid Criticism of Trump

Ocasio-Cortez’s Fundraising Surges Amid Criticism of Trump

News EditorBy News EditorApril 15, 2025 U.S. News 6 Mins Read

In a remarkable display of grassroots fundraising, Representative Alexandria Ocasio-Cortez (D-NY) has reported a staggering $9.6 million raised in the first quarter of 2025. This notable financial accomplishment reflects a more than fivefold increase from the same quarter last year, signaling her growing influence within the Democratic Party. Simultaneously, Ocasio-Cortez and fellow progressive Senator Bernie Sanders (I-VT) have been actively campaigning across the nation through their “Fighting Oligarchy” rallies, which attract large crowds and resonate with many Americans who are concerned about the role of wealth in politics.

Ocasio-Cortez’s Fundraising Surge

In an unusual reveal, the latest report from campaign financing indicates that Alexandria Ocasio-Cortez raised an impressive $9.6 million during the first quarter of 2025, setting a record for her fundraising efforts. This amount overshadowed her previous fundraising totals, as the figure reflects a significant increase from the $1.8 million she raised for the same period the previous year. The increase can be attributed to her rising visibility as a leading progressive voice in Congress and her ability to mobilize grassroots support.

The donations came from a varied base of supporters, illustrating Ocasio-Cortez’s ability to connect with the electorate on pressing issues. Her campaign filing reveals that a substantial proportion of the funds were accumulated from small-dollar contributions, indicating a strong grassroots movement backing her initiatives. Ocasio-Cortez’s strong performance in fundraising is reflective not only of her popularity but also of a strategic campaign philosophy that prioritizes engaging everyday citizens over affluent donors.

The “Fighting Oligarchy” Movement

Together with Senator Bernie Sanders, Ocasio-Cortez has been campaigning under the banner of the “Fighting Oligarchy” movement. This political campaign has taken them to several cities across the United States, including Los Angeles, wherein they’ve attracted large crowds eager to hear their message. The rallies serve as platforms to identify and criticize the perceived excesses of the wealthy elite and their influence in politics. Both speakers frame their message around a focus on reducing income inequality, tackling corporate greed, and promoting policies centered on working-class Americans.

The movement’s emphasis on community engagement and organization has been successful in boosting attendance even in traditionally conservative areas. Ocasio-Cortez and Sanders have positioned themselves as advocates for change, inspiring audiences to think critically about the political system and encouraging them to take an active role within their communities. The vibrant energy at the rallies has helped solidify their reputations as transformative leaders who resonate with a broad spectrum of the electorate.

Challenges within the Democratic Party

Despite her significant fundraising success, Ocasio-Cortez faces internal party challenges, particularly within the Democratic Party hierarchy. Recent criticism has emerged against fellow Democratic leaders, specifically aimed at Senate Minority Leader Chuck Schumer, who has been accused of failing to direct the party toward effective strategies. Schumer’s reported fundraising figure of only $144,742 during the same quarter raises questions about his influence and effectiveness in rallying support for the party after losses in the previous elections.

Progressives are advocating for fresh leadership within the party, seeking a move away from centrist strategies. Ocasio-Cortez herself has been floated as a potential primary challenger to Schumer in the upcoming 2028 elections. This speculation reflects the palpable frustration within the party as it grapples with identity and strategy following a series of electoral defeats. Activists are increasingly vocal about the need for Democratic leadership that more accurately reflects their progressive values and the changing political landscape.

The Importance of Small Donations

A key aspect of Ocasio-Cortez’s fundraising success is the noteworthy percentage of small donations she has garnered. According to Federal Election Commission records, 64% of her donations during the first quarter were from first-time contributors. This statistic amplifies her narrative of being a champion of the people, reinforcing the idea that her campaign is built on community support rather than corporate interests. Ocasio-Cortez tweeted her gratitude, thanking supporters for contributing their “time, resources, & energy” which has made the rallying of communities possible.

The average donation amount was remarkably low, standing at just $21, demonstrating a profound connection with a wide swath of the electorate who may feel disenfranchised by larger political donations. Ocasio-Cortez’s campaign manager, Oliver Hidalgo-Wohlleben, highlighted that this influx of small donations contributes to a year-round organizing presence in her district, NY-14. It fortifies their capacity to host rallies and engage voters in politically significant discussions across the country.

Future Political Implications

Ocasio-Cortez’s future in politics appears promising yet fraught with challenges as she navigates the currents of progressive advocacy, party dynamics, and electoral strategies. Should she choose to challenge Schumer in 2028, she would be stepping onto a highly competitive stage, with significant implications for the ideological direction of the Democratic Party. Her rising star within the party indicates a shift away from traditional Democratic norms toward a more progressive strategy that prioritizes social justice, economic equality, and environmental sustainability.

The increasing support for her methods and messages may offer the Democratic Party a renewed sense of purpose attracting a younger set of voters disillusioned with centrist politics. As she continues to signal hope and resilience in her messaging, Ocasio-Cortez is poised to play a central role in shaping the future of progressive politics in America, utilizing her fundraising success to amplify her outreach and vision.
